Robot Vacuum Cleaner - How It Can Help You Keep Your Floors Clean

Robot vacuums are a great method to mop, sweep, and vacuum without straining or bent over. They can be programmed to follow schedules by using the controls on the device.

ilife-robot-vacuum-and-mop-combo-v3s-proSensors aid in navigating obstacles. The more advanced models utilize cameras or lasers to map rooms to aid in cleaning.

1. Clean and Effortless

Robot vacuums are a great "set it and forget it" tool. They can keep your floors cleaner and reduce the amount you have to clean on a daily basis. Advanced features let you schedule automatic cleanings, create zones that you want to keep it away from and monitor its progress through the smartphone app.

Most Shark Ai Ultra Robot Vacuum vacuums employ combination of sensors to navigate and detect obstacles in your home. Sensors that face downwards that detect coffee tables, chair legs and sofas are standard and more sophisticated models might have forward-facing cameras, lasers or even lasers that enable them to locate furniture and rooms. These sensors are then used to direct the robot to clean those areas and, more specifically, avoid obstacles.

Even the most intelligent robot vacuums cannot navigate your home in a perfect manner. They are often tripped by thresholds for doors and rug thickness, as well as stray shoelaces or cords. They also can get caught on furniture that is low or under it, and require human intervention to release their own. It is normal to find them tangled up, since humans are not able to navigate around a room in a precise manner.

2. Saves Time

Robot vacuums allow you to automate cleaning chores and forget about them. This can make time work on tasks that require human hands or just relax. You can set the machine to clean when you are working or taking a vacation.

Look for models that have smart mapping capabilities. These models make use of cameras, gyroscopes, or radar guided systems to create maps of your home and follow their movements. These maps allow the robot to avoid repeating the same area repeatedly, making the task go by more quickly.

Many robot vacuums also come with dirt sensors to stop them from bumping into furniture or lingering on dirty spots. These features guarantee a thorough and efficient cleaning. With the application, you can set up virtual boundaries to prevent the robot from entering certain rooms such as a child's bedroom. Some have a physical barrier that you can shut, and some have magnetic boundary tape which you can put on furniture to rope off no-go zones.

You'll have to perform routine maintenance on your robot regardless of how sophisticated it is. This includes getting rid of any hair that is tangled around the brushes, emptying and cleaning the dust bin following each cleaning session, and cleaning the sensors and cameras.

Because of their more complex components, robot vacs can be more costly to maintain and repair than traditional barrel vacuums. They are more likely to be affected by defective sensors, battery problems, and other issues that are either impossible or difficult to fix, which could increase the cost of ownership in the long haul. But, by ensuring that you're in line with the recommended maintenance schedule, you will prolong the life of your robot and increase its performance.

4. Easy to Operate

Robot vacuums operate on an established schedule, making it easy to keep your home tidy. Set it to run multiple times each week, and your floors will be free from dust, pet hairs, lint, and surface dirt.

Most modern robot vacuums are controlled via an app. This makes them easy to use from anywhere. Most models can set up a cleaning schedule and then check the virtual map to track the progress of your robot. You can also create 'virtual wall zones that will block your robot vacuum from accessing certain areas of your home. By using the app, you can manually steer your robot vac or select different modes, like Auto which moves it from room to room, Spot, which focuses on a specific area and Edge that lets it hug your home's walls to clean the perimeter.

The latest models are equipped with mapping capabilities that operate on gyro, camera or radar-guided system. Mapping allows your robovac to determine the most efficient route to your home, which will improve its efficiency and reduce the amount of times it has to go back over previously cleaned spaces. The most recent robots are able to store multiple floor plans in order to maximize efficiency. If the battery is exhausted, shark ai ultra robot vacuum they can return to their docks and recharge or continue cleaning where they left off.

Most robots are less maintenance-intensive than conventional vacuums. However, you must be sure to empty the dust bin and wipe it down regularly. It is also important to clean the brushes on the sides and the brush, as well as the filters. If you take good care of your robotic vacuum cleaner, you can prolong its life and ensure it is operating at its peak.
